From 04d1ee0f7ec7a280136ddf5f3f34d6282a50846d Mon Sep 17 00:00:00 2001 From: Lennart Poettering Date: Wed, 22 Apr 2020 22:49:02 +0200 Subject: [PATCH] main: bump RLIMIT_MEMLOCK by physical RAM size Let's allow more memory to be locked on beefy machines than on small ones. The previous limit of 64M is the lower bound still. This effectively means on a 4GB machine we can lock 512M, which should be more than enough, but still not lock up the machine entirely under pressure.
